The Birks Cinema in Aberfeldy is celebrating its fifth anniversary this year.  Five years ago members of the community achieved their dream to bring back the magic of cinema to Highland Perthshire.  After several years fund raising they were able to reopen the cinema that had closed in the 1980s.We are celebrating our anniversary with  fund raising and other events including our sponsored abseil on 14th April .  It's a unique  opportunity to abseil  from the cinema roof and our goal is to raise £6000When we started the community cinema it received hundreds of thousands of pounds from bodies like government, the big lottery fund and many others. Our plan was to get it up and running and wean ourselves off grant funds for core activities over a four year period,This has been achieved and in year five we have achieved a break even result without revenue supportLooking to the next five years we need to raise money to keep the cinema building in top conditionAll the money raised will go directly to maintenance of the cinema as our partners Wee Adventures are giving their time, expertise and equipment to run the event.Thank you for supporting our community cinema    Charity No: SC360708

Yaknak Projects is a small Scottish charity that runs two childrens homes in Nepal. Kapan House and Banglamukhi House are situated on the outskirts of Kathmandu and are each home to eight boys, Ama (Nepali mum) and Didi (big sister). The boys were previously living on the streets of Kathmandu or were displaced by civil war and unable to return home to their villages. They now live in safe, family-style homes, are well cared for and attend local schools.   Yaknak was set up by four friends in 2004 and needs just £16,000 a year to run both houses. That pays for food, clothing, healthcare, school fees, social activities and salaries for their live in carers and house manger, all locally recruited Nepalis. Nutrition plays a pivotal role in health. There is a gap in the nutritional status of most people today, which an apparently wholesome, balanced diet may fail to correct. This worldwide problem is severe in Africa. Even when a person consumes adequate calories and protein, if they lack one single micronutrient or a combination of vitamins and minerals, their immune system is compromised and infections take hold. HETN aims to research and apply appropriate nutritional intervention in the prevention and management of disease. Our projects include crèche feeding, nutritional support for orphans, vulnerable children and people living with AIDS and TB.
